Ingredients
- 300 g lamb bone broth
- 300 g lamb pieces
- 3 cloves garlic
- 1 (juiced) lemon
- 2 pieces red pepper flakes
Method
- Heat a heavy-bottomed pot over medium-high heat and sear the lamb pieces for 4-5 minutes until browned on all sides to develop a deep, roasted flavor.
- Add the garlic cloves to the pot and cook for 2 minutes until fragrant, stirring to coat them in the rendered lamb fat.
- Pour in the lamb bone broth and bring the soup to a boil, then reduce the heat to low and add the red pepper flakes.
- Simmer the soup uncovered for approximately 25 minutes until the lamb pieces are tender and the broth has slightly reduced and deepened in flavor.
- Squeeze the lemon juice into the pot during the final 2 minutes of simmering, stirring to incorporate the brightness into the broth.
- Ladle the soup into bowls and serve hot, garnished with an extra pinch of red pepper flakes if desired.
